Darren Locke will find out on Friday whether he needs surgery to repair the fractures to the right side of his face.

Locke clashed heads with Stuart Farrell in St Albans City’s 3-2 over Arlesey Town on February 4. He was taken to hospital after the game where an x-ray revealed he had “multiple” fractures.

He had a consoltation with specialist on Monday at Luton and Dunstable Hospital.

Ahead of Monday’s game with Bideford Locke confirmed he will get a 3D x-ray on Friday and, if neeeded, surgery on the same day.
